Woodford is a small village built around the heritage-listed Woodford Academy, and at 609m it runs noticeably cooler than Sydney for most of the year. Regular winter frost and a shorter mowing season are part of the deal here, and the deciduous trees around the village and the Academy grounds put on a proper leaf-fall each autumn that needs clearing before it smothers the lawn underneath.
Houses sit on bushland-fringe blocks either side of the Great Western Highway and railway line (2778), from heritage cottages near the Academy precinct to more recent family homes further out. With Woodford Park and the Oaks Track and St Helena Track trailhead close by, a lot of these gardens back onto bush, so we keep the cut tidy and the clippings properly cleared rather than left to blow around.

Spring brings the growth flush after the winter dormancy eases. Summer stays milder here than down in Sydney, though the lawn still wants a steady rhythm rather than long gaps between cuts. Autumn is leaf season across the village and around the Academy grounds, with genuine clean-up work to match. Winter brings regular frost mornings that slow growth right down until spring gets going again.

Yes — at 609m Woodford sees regular winter frost and a mowing season that runs shorter than Sydney's. We pull the interval back through the coldest months and pick the pace back up once spring growth returns.
Woodford sits on sandstone-derived soils that are cool and reasonably moisture-retentive, which suits established cool-season lawns and garden beds better than warm-season couch. We adjust the cutting height so lawns hold up through the colder stretches.
